Your child is having fever with upper respiratory symptoms which is mostly viral in nature and settles in few days.
-I suggest yo to monitor fever every 4 to 6 hourly.
-Give paracetamol in case fever is above 100F every 4 to 6 hourly.
-Do tepid sponging if fever is above 102F.
-You can give meftal p 4ml 2 to 3 times a day.
-Give plenty of fluids and soft bland diet to maintain hydration and nutrition.
-For relief of cold and cough you can give benadryl syrup 2.5 ml 3 times a day.
-Maintain good hygiene.
This is good that she is not having any other symptom.
In case fever persist after 48 hours I suggest you to get her examined by pediatrician for further evaluation.
